Output ec76000186f366e8c14ee231156584c1a0b0c92538a545e6e6cbfb1b55094a0f:1

value
1584061111
script pubkey
OP_0 OP_PUSHBYTES_20 42779d4c84cc573c852cbfc289a596226a19a06b
address
ltc1qgfme6nyye3tnepfvhlpgnfvkyf4pngrtcrpewa
transaction
ec76000186f366e8c14ee231156584c1a0b0c92538a545e6e6cbfb1b55094a0f
spent
true